
If your pet shakes its head, scratches its ears or has a bad ear odour, it may be otitis — one of the most common complaints in dogs and cats.
Why it happens
Otitis is caused by bacteria, yeast, parasites, allergies or foreign bodies. It often returns because the underlying cause was not treated.
How we treat it
We use otoscopic examination and cytology to pinpoint the cause, so the treatment is targeted, effective and lasting.
